Beverly Cleary's 'Lucky Chuck' is a charming and humorous picture book that tackles the important topic of safety rules through the adventures of a boy and his bike. Chuck, eager for fun, decides to ignore some basic safety precautions, leading to a series of comical mishaps. The story gently illustrates the natural consequences of his choices without being overly preachy or scary. The emotional arc is lighthearted, starting with Chuck's carefree spirit, moving through his minor predicaments, and concluding with a subtle understanding of why rules exist. This book is ideal for children aged 3-7 who are just learning to ride bikes or testing boundaries. Parents might reach for this when their child is becoming more independent and needs a gentle reminder about safety, or simply for a fun read-aloud that sparks conversation about responsibility. The updated illustrations add a fresh appeal to this classic tale.
